3. Kalshi has reportedly begun IPO talks with investment banks after surpassing $2B in annualized revenue and reaching a $22B valuation in its latest funding round - The Block
π·οΈ Revenue β’ Kalshi β’ IPO
π¬ $22B is a public-market comp for prediction markets before the regulatory perimeter is settled, with CME suing the CFTC over Kalshi-linked perps and states still trying to tax or classify event contracts like sportsbooks. If bankers get this out, Polymarket/QCEX and the onchain orderbook crowd get a valuation anchor, but the equity story lives or dies on CFTC preemption and whether sports/event flow turns into durable exchange fees instead of promo-driven betting churn. β @Benthic
4. Token Terminal launches redesigned stablecoin and RWA issuer dashboards, giving investors deeper insights into product mix, market share and chain distribution - π/@tokenterminal
π·οΈ Real World Assets β’ Investment β’ Markets
π¬ $301.4B of Token Terminal's tokenized-asset universe sits in stablecoins versus $44.1B RWAs, so the near-term allocator lens is issuer balance sheets and distribution chokepoints. Tether at 98.5% USDT with 97.3% of issued assets on Ethereum+Tron makes chain mix a live concentration metric, while Circle's USYC and Ondo's USDY/OUSG/equities show how stablecoin rails can turn into an onchain asset-management stack. TVL alone misses the trade: redemption mechanics, product breadth, and where the liabilities circulate are going to decide which issuers get treated like money-market funds versus DeFi wrappers. β @Benthic
